Biography of Lauritta Onye: Nigerian Paralympic Gold Medalist | Para Athletics Lauritta Onye: Nigeria's Paralympic Shot Put Powerhouse

Introduction: A Beacon of Nigerian Sporting Excellence

Lauritta Onye stands as one of Nigeria's most celebrated and dominant athletes in the world of Para Athletics. Born in 1982, Onye has carved her name into the annals of sports history as a Paralympic Gold Medalist, a world champion, and a formidable world record holder. Competing in the F40 classification for athletes of short stature, her specialization in shot put and discus throw has brought immense glory to Nigeria on the global stage. Her defining moment came at the 2016 Summer Paralympics in Rio de Janeiro, where she not only clinched the gold medal in the women's shot put F40 event but did so in spectacular fashion by setting a new world record with a throw of 8.40 meters. Lauritta Onye's journey from humble beginnings to the pinnacle of her sport is a powerful narrative of resilience, talent, and unwavering determination, making her an iconic figure in Nigerian and international sports.

Early Life & Education: The Foundation of a Champion

Lauritta Onye was born in 1982 in Nigeria. Details about her specific hometown and early childhood are kept relatively private, but it is known that she was born with achondroplasia, a common form of dwarfism. This physical characteristic would later define her athletic classification but never her spirit or ambition. Growing up in Nigeria, Onye faced the societal challenges and accessibility issues that many persons with disabilities encounter. However, she exhibited a resilient and competitive spirit from a young age.

Her formal education and initial career path were not in athletics. Lauritta Onye pursued higher education and earned a degree in Theatre Arts from the University of Abuja. This academic background in the arts highlights the diverse talents and interests she possesses beyond the sports field. Her foray into sports was not an early childhood dream but a discovery made later in life. It was her innate strength and competitive drive that were eventually channeled into Para athletics. The structured environment of university life and the discipline required for theatrical performance may have inadvertently provided a foundation for the focus and dedication needed for elite sports. The transition from theatre arts to becoming a world-class athlete is a unique aspect of Onye's story, demonstrating that the path to sporting greatness can begin at any stage and from any background.

Career & Major Achievements: A Meteoric Rise to Gold

Lauritta Onye's athletic career, while starting later than some, is marked by a rapid ascent to the very top of her discipline. She burst onto the international scene with remarkable impact, announcing her arrival as a force to be reckoned with in Para athletics.

Dominance on the World Stage

Onye's first major international medal came at the 2015 IPC Athletics World Championships in Doha, Qatar. There, she won the gold medal in the shot put F40 event, showcasing her potential on the eve of the Paralympic Games. This victory was a clear signal of her readiness for the biggest stage of all.

The pinnacle of her career was reached at the 2016 Rio Paralympic Games. In the women's shot put F40 final, Lauritta Onye delivered a performance for the ages. With her very first throw, she launched the shot to a distance of 8.40 meters, shattering the existing world record. This throw was so dominant that it secured the gold medal immediately, leaving her competitors to battle for the remaining podium spots. The image of her triumphant celebration became an iconic moment for Nigerian Paralympic sport.

Her success continued beyond Rio. At the 2017 World Para Athletics Championships in London, she defended her world title in the shot put F40, further cementing her status as the undisputed best in the world. She also secured a bronze medal in the discus throw F40 at the same championships, proving her versatility. Onye added to her medal haul with a silver medal in the shot put at the 2019 World Para Athletics Championships in Dubai.

Accolades and Recognition

Lauritta Onye's achievements have been recognized with numerous honors in Nigeria, a country that deeply values sporting success. Her contributions have been celebrated by both sports authorities and the government. Key accolades include:

  • Winner of the 2015 Nigerian Sports Award for Para-Sportswoman of the Year.
  • Recognition and awards from the Paralympics Committee of Nigeria.
  • Being celebrated as a national hero whose performances have inspired a new generation of athletes with disabilities in Nigeria and across Africa.

Personal Life & Legacy: Beyond the Podium

Outside of the intense world of competition, Lauritta Onye is known to be a private individual who enjoys a life beyond athletics. Her background in Theatre Arts from the University of Abuja suggests a creative and expressive side. While she keeps much of her personal life out of the public eye, her public persona is one of joy, confidence, and fierce patriotism, often seen proudly displaying the Nigerian flag after her victories.

The legacy of Lauritta Onye is profound and multifaceted. As a Paralympic Gold Medalist from Nigeria, she has played a crucial role in elevating the profile of Para sports in a nation where able-bodied sports often dominate headlines. She has become a role model, demonstrating that disability is not an impediment to achieving extraordinary success. Her world-record performance in Rio provided a monumental moment of national pride and increased visibility for athletes with disabilities. Onye's success, along with that of her teammates, has helped to advocate for better support, funding, and recognition for Paralympic athletes in Nigeria. She has inspired young Nigerians, both with and without disabilities, to pursue their dreams with tenacity. Her story is a testament to the idea that with talent, hard work, and opportunity, any barrier can be overcome.
